Transaction 580b823ee2c38a78410efac5a399a320ae4cff706a00e36deaf287e1bd5ef955
1 Input
1 Output
-
580b823ee2c38a78410efac5a399a320ae4cff706a00e36deaf287e1bd5ef955:0
- value
- 306469
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fd48302345867f9316913266680ee9d6d6ed08d
- address
- bc1qhl2gxq35tpnljvtfzvnxdq8wn4kka5yde67dhr